One highlighted story featured a dedicated group of female divers from Khorfakkan. They documented the environmental changes in the Al Qalqali Marine Reserve through their photography. Sheikh Fahim explained that such initiatives are crucial because they convey the importance of preserving our oceans and help people understand the challenges our ecosystems face.
Speaking to “Sharjah 24”, Sheikh Fahim noted that using photography to capture marine and natural environments is important. It not only tells a story but also serves as a powerful educational tool. Images can effectively convey the realities of environmental issues and inspire the community to adopt responsible practices that protect our natural resources.
In closing, Sheikh Fahim urged everyone to support artistic projects focused on the environment. He believes these initiatives play a vital role in creating awareness and fostering a culture of environmental conservation for future generations.
